Comment représenter une base de données : Comprendre les bases

Comment représenter une base de données ?
Pour concevoir une base de données efficace et utile, vous devez suivre le bon processus, qui comprend les phases suivantes : Analyse des besoins, c’est-à-dire l’identification de l’objet de votre base de données. Organisation des données en tables. Spécification des clés primaires et analyse des relations.
En savoir plus sur www.lucidchart.com


Une base de données est une collection organisée de données auxquelles on peut accéder, que l’on peut gérer et mettre à jour facilement. Elle sert de dépôt central de données pour une organisation ou un individu. L’objectif d’une base de données est de stocker des données de manière structurée, ce qui permet de les récupérer et de les manipuler facilement. Les bases de données sont utilisées dans un large éventail d’applications, notamment dans le domaine des affaires, de l’éducation, de la santé et de l’administration.


Il existe deux principaux types de bases de données : SQL et NoSQL. SQL signifie Structured Query Language (langage de requête structuré) et est un langage utilisé pour gérer les bases de données relationnelles. Les bases de données relationnelles stockent les données dans des tables, où chaque ligne représente un enregistrement unique et chaque colonne représente un champ de données. Les bases de données NoSQL, quant à elles, n’utilisent pas de tableaux pour stocker les données. Elles utilisent plutôt une variété de modèles de données, tels que le document, la clé-valeur ou le graphe, en fonction des besoins spécifiques de l’application.


Pour gérer les données dans une base de données relationnelle, plusieurs instructions sont utilisées. Les instructions les plus courantes en SQL sont SELECT, INSERT, UPDATE et DELETE. L’instruction SELECT permet d’extraire des données d’une table, tandis que l’instruction INSERT permet d’ajouter de nouvelles données à une table. L’instruction UPDATE est utilisée pour modifier les données existantes d’une table, tandis que l’instruction DELETE est utilisée pour supprimer des données d’une table.


Une clé primaire est un identifiant unique pour chaque enregistrement dans une base de données relationnelle. Elle permet de s’assurer que chaque enregistrement d’une table est unique et peut être facilement récupéré. Par exemple, dans une table appelée « client », la clé primaire peut être l’identifiant du client.

Il existe plusieurs types de SGBD, ou systèmes de gestion de base de données. Parmi les SGBD les plus populaires, citons MySQL, Oracle, Microsoft SQL Server et PostgreSQL. Chaque SGBD possède ses propres caractéristiques et capacités, il est donc important de choisir celui qui correspond à vos besoins et exigences spécifiques.

En conclusion, la représentation d’une base de données nécessite de comprendre les bases de SQL et NoSQL, ainsi que les instructions utilisées pour gérer les données dans une base de données relationnelle. Il faut également comprendre les clés primaires et les différents SGBD disponibles. En comprenant ces concepts, vous pouvez créer une base de données de haute qualité qui répond à vos besoins et à vos exigences.

FAQ
Nous pouvons également nous demander ce que sont les bases de données relationnelles ?

Les bases de données relationnelles sont un type de base de données qui organise les données en une ou plusieurs tables, chaque table étant constituée d’un ensemble de lignes et de colonnes. Les tables sont reliées entre elles par un champ commun, ce qui permet d’extraire et de manipuler facilement les données. Les bases de données relationnelles sont largement utilisées dans les applications modernes et sont considérées comme la norme en matière de stockage et de gestion des données.

Quel est le meilleur logiciel pour créer une base de données ?

Il n’existe pas de réponse unique à la question de savoir quel est le meilleur logiciel pour créer une base de données, car cela dépend en grande partie de vos besoins et préférences spécifiques. Parmi les systèmes de gestion de base de données les plus répandus, citons MySQL, Oracle, Microsoft SQL Server et PostgreSQL. Il existe également plusieurs logiciels de base de données conviviaux, tels que Microsoft Access et FileMaker Pro. En fin de compte, le meilleur logiciel pour créer une base de données dépendra de facteurs tels que la taille et la complexité de vos données, votre budget et votre expertise technique.

Quels sont donc les trois concepts fondamentaux des bases de données relationnelles ?

Les trois concepts fondamentaux des bases de données relationnelles sont les suivants :

1. les tables : Une table est un ensemble de données organisées en lignes et en colonnes. Chaque ligne représente un enregistrement unique et chaque colonne représente un champ ou un attribut de cet enregistrement.

2. Les relations : Les relations définissent les liens entre les tables d’une base de données. Il peut s’agir de relations un à un, un à plusieurs ou plusieurs à plusieurs.

3. clés : Les clés sont utilisées pour identifier de manière unique chaque enregistrement d’une table. Les clés primaires sont utilisées pour identifier un seul enregistrement, tandis que les clés étrangères sont utilisées pour relier les enregistrements entre les tables.


Laisser un commentaire